Wanted a cheap 4 door saloon, I like Jap cars and I love v8s. Front engine rear wheel drive perfect for track days. Something a bit different.
 Quoting: Anonymous Coward 79504291


When I was in high school and my first year of college I had a 240-Z I got for a song.

I wish I still had that car but by the time I sold it , it was rusted very badly from the northern New York salt.


If I were you though I would leave the original engine in it, what you want to do is not easy and will give you endless problems. It used to be you could just take one engine out one car and put it in any other essentially with a few modifications, now the entire electrical system is linked to that engine and its computer.
 Quoting: Anonymous Coward 83586973


I bet you enjoyed that 240 especially in college years, I had an MR2 mk2 NA at 18 lol loved it.

I’m not going ahead with the car and conversion anyway as I’m saving but the 1UZFE drops in on the standard mounts and there’s plenty of gearbox conversion kits here to mount up to the j160 (and others) and most people just use the ls400 ecu but I’d have gone full standalone Link as I intended on upgrading gearbox and power later on.

My sister recently bought a Corolla Cross, apparently there aren't too many on the road yet. She gets calls from the dealership asking if she'll bring it in because people want to see the actual vehicle and they have none.

Manufacturer's aren't sending cars to lots anymore, where my sister bought hers, they were having people order cars for a $500 deposit and then when the cars got there, the people got their money back. Only way they can get a car on the lot now.
